Ulrik Andersen is a Partner with nearly 30 years of experience as an auditor, including 20 years working abroad. He has extensive expertise in auditing large, international, publicly listed companies and advising on complex financial reporting and compliance matters.
He holds an MSc in Business Administration and Auditing and is a Certified Public Accountant (CPA) in the U.S. Ulrik is also an Approved Sustainability Auditor and has completed the KPMG Global Lead Partner Program in cooperation with Harvard Business Publishing.
Ulrik has significant experience in auditing multinational groups under IFRS and PCAOB standards. His industry expertise spans exploration and processing of mineral resources, manufacturing, construction, healthcare and pharma, transportation, online business, services, trading, FMCG (tobacco, electronics, and F&B), and retail. He has also worked extensively with IPOs and other capital markets transactions.
Throughout his career, Ulrik has held several leadership positions, including Director and daily operational leader of KPMG's office in the Ural region, Partner at KPMG CIS (Commonwealth of Independent States), Head of the Automotive Sector in CIS (including membership in KPMG's Global and EMA Automotive Steering Groups), and Head of DPP (Department for Professional Practice) within Assurance, where he focused on audit quality.
